An exceptional quality mid-19th century, William IV Period, rosewood writing table having blind tooled leather inset to crossbanded top, over two drawers with original turned wooden knobs opposed by two false drawers, to extremely elegant shallow frieze, raised on reverse tapered, faceted, end supports with elegant carved scrolling feet and original recessed brass castors. Dating to the William IV period, which of course has a most distinctive style of its own sitting, despite not lasting very long between the late regency and victorian periods of english furniture making, this writing table has a lot of stand out features. Firstly it is a great size. A little bigger than many, indeed big enough to use as a day to day desk for working at, whilst not being overpoweringly large like many earlier georgian writing tables which one may find. It is also of exceptional quality. Clearly constructed in a top workshop it is constructed using high end, decorative rosewood veneers on the outside and a lot of mahogany as secondary timbers on the inside which is a great sign of quality. The entire table oozes class and sophistication in fact from top to bottom. The original turned wooden knobs are a nice feature, as is the high support...

    To tell if a rocking horse is a Collinson, look at the pillar on its safety stand. Authentic pieces will usually have square pillars with wooden diamonds on top. The iron swings that allow the horse to rock were often red on genuine Collinson designs. However, an antique rocking horse may have been repainted, so the color you see might not be the original.
